In truth, I'm a bit disappointed with the current balance of the game. I made tweaks after the playtest, but there are core issues that can only be resolved after I add new features & mechanics. In the next update, most of the cards will be completely reworked or replaced.

3 months ago 1 0 1 0

When I learned I got accepted to Playtest Planet, I had maybe 10 cards in the game. In two weeks I added 5x that many. There was no way to truly balance it all in such a short time.

If TorchBear ever becomes a full game, I would like it to include:
- Path choices (more Hades than StS)
- Unique event rooms
- Relics
- New torch elements (fire, _______, _____)
- 3 characters with dif decks/abilities (grizzly, polar, & sun bear)
- (hopefully) 3 secret unlockable characters

To do list of features, that may come with this upcoming upload or the one after:
- A more scripted, linear tutorial experience
- Enemy tooltips
- Improved symbol language
- Complex cards become unlockable (to not overcomplicate the early game)
